Job Description
As a Senior Driving Instructor, you will be responsible for delivering high-quality driving tuition to learners of all abilities, preparing them for their practical driving tests and beyond. You will need to demonstrate an exceptional understanding of the UK driving curriculum, traffic laws, and safe driving practices. The ability to adapt your teaching style to suit individual learning needs and paces is paramount. Whilst the role is remote in its management and operational aspects, instruction will occur in person with students as per industry standard.
A significant part of your role will involve managing your own client bookings, scheduling lessons, and maintaining accurate records of student progress. You will be expected to provide constructive feedback, build rapport with your students, and maintain a patient, encouraging, and professional demeanour at all times. You will also be responsible for ensuring your vehicle is maintained to the highest safety standards and complies with all DVSA regulations.
We are looking for highly motivated, self-disciplined individuals with a proven track record in driving instruction. A full, clean UK driving licence and a current DVSA Approved Driving Instructor (ADI) registration are mandatory. Excellent communication, interpersonal, and time-management skills are essential for success in this role.
